Louisiana native Laine Hardy made it into the Top 8 during last night’s episode of American Idol

It was Disney night on the Idol stage and the singers performed songs from classic Disney movies. Laine, who is competing for the second time, sang “Oo-De-Lally” from Robin Hood.

Hardy first competed on American Idol in 2018, making it all the way to Hollywood before being eliminated. This year, Laine made it to the show unexpectedly after showing up to auditions to support a friend.

The judges convinced Hardy to audition and he received a ticket

Now in the Top 8, Hardy has only a few more weeks of competition to capture the Idol crown.

On Monday, April 22, ABC will air a two-hour special called American Idol: Meet Your Finalists. The special will take a closer look at each finalist, their stories, and include new, never-before-seen songs, performances and footage from the show.

Live performances and voting will resume Sunday, April 28.
